Homework Statement



Plot the result on the grid.

Percentage concentration of carbon dioxide: 0.00, 0.02, 0.04, 0.06, 0.08, 0.10, 0.12, 0.14, 0.16, 0.18, 0.20

Rate of photosynthesis in arbitrary units
low light intensity: 0, 20, 29, 35, 39, 42, 45, 46, 46,46,...
high light intensity: 0, 33, 53, 68, 79, 86, 89, 90, 90, 90,...

The question is asking you to plot both sets of results on the same graph. The two sets of results are these: (*)percent concentration carbon dioxide versus low intensity rate in arbitrary units, and (*)percent concentration carbon dioxide versus high intensity rate in arbitrary units. For graphs, plotting the points is straightforward.

If you want to plot onto a grid, and if by "grid" you mean table of data, then you can simply use a row for percent concentration of carbon dioxide, a row for the low intensity rate, and a row for the high intensity data. Each coordinate needs to correspond in each column.
